In 2014, we set out to create a better way to get work done in the oil & gas industry. The goal — to build the most reliable and cost-effective workforce solution, using technology to make it easier to manage and deploy workers at scale. And while our commitment hasn’t changed, our business has. What started in oil & gas has grown to include construction, wind, solar, and defense. So we believe it’s time our company’s name reflects that evolution. We’re excited to announce that RigUp is now Workrise— a full-stack workforce provider, powered by technology specifically built for the diverse industries we serve.
